The cheapest way to get from Millbrook to Greenwich is to bus which costs $5 - $14 and takes 4h 7m.
The fastest way to get from Millbrook to Greenwich is to drive which takes 1h 26m and costs $11 - $17.
No, there is no direct bus from Millbrook to Greenwich. However, there are services departing from Front Street & Franklin Avenue and arriving at Broad St @ Irving Ave via Metro North Station and Main St @ S Broadway.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 7m.
No, there is no direct train from Millbrook to Greenwich. However, there are services departing from Poughkeepsie and arriving at Greenwich via 125th Street - Harlem.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 17m.
The distance between Millbrook and Greenwich is 110 miles. The road distance is 65 miles.
The best way to get from Millbrook to Greenwich without a car is to train which takes 3h 17m and costs $28 - $45.
It takes approximately 3h 17m to get from Millbrook to Greenwich, including transfers.
Millbrook to Greenwich bus services, operated by Dutchess County Public Transit, depart from Front Street & Franklin Avenue station.
Millbrook to Greenwich train services, operated by Metro-North Railroad (MNR), depart from Poughkeepsie station.
The best way to get from Millbrook to Greenwich is to train which takes 3h 17m and costs $28 - $45.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s $5 - $14 and takes 4h 7m.
